    Lyme Time Game Recap

    The LG Wchl Rockets took on the Anxiety this week. The first half of the period looked like the Rockets we're in control but Anxiety scores there first shot with a One Tee in the high slot. Moving forward from their the game was pretty balanced but Anxiety was getting pucks in the middle forcing the Rockets tendy to make some saves. They tie the game up as an Anxiety defender seems to be M.I.A but they answer back and the period ends 2-1. The majority of the game is extremely tight as both teams clog the slots and disallow any easy entry, only a few point and out wide shots get to the net in the second. The entirety of the third plays out exactly the same and the next play that gets through offensively will probably be the only opportunity to tie or finish the game. With 3:03 left in the third the Rockets one man skates behind the net back and fourth then comes out front around half of the Anxiety players as he send a ONE TEE across the ice for a 3-1 lead. The game is visibly all but lost and the Rockets bury more in the last minute than the whole game for a 5-1 finish.
    Third Star @Naazzyy - 1G 4A
    Second Star @SurpriseMe22 - 2G 3A
    First Star @K1eetus - 2G 3A
